WebFold the table up and mount a gate latch’s striker arm to a wood spacer that extends just beyond the frame front; fasten the spacer to the top’s underside next to the frame. Slip the latch behind the arm, so it catches. Drill pilot holes, then fasten with masonry screws. “The new bench is lower, about 32 inches off the ground,” says Tom.
